On Tue, 2 Dec 2003, Jonathan Hutchins wrote: > Recent troubles with the Debian distributions turn out to be the result of a > kernel exploit, according to yesterday's article on Slashdot: Its a local exploit, meaning a user must have access on the system to take over. Here is a discussion with an included test script to see if your kernel is vulnerable: http://lists.netsys.com/pipermail/full-disclosure/2003-December.txt.gz If you have people logging into your computer with permissions to create and run processes, *then* this is something you have to worry about.
